Ideals are great, but I agree. Once the pup is with you, then focus on supporting it's development not to worry about that week with it's Dam that's missing. It does make puppy socialistation more important, which is reason I talked about it. With a young vacinated pup, you do want to make sure it's a good group, not one where older boisterous dogs are barking in a stressed small enclosed space.
